A stock of 200 million illegally imported cigarettes has been destroyed by Sri Lanka Customs at a storage yard in Kerawalapitiya.
State Minister for Finance Ranjith Siyambalapitiya mentioned the value of the stock is estimated to be around Rs. 15 billion.
The stock of cigarettes destroyed was expropriated by Sri Lanka Customs in a number of instances since 2021.
